- The distance between Princeton, In, Usa and Jerba, Tunisia is approximately 8,441 km or 5,246 mi.
- To reach Princeton, In in this distance one would set out from Jerba bearing 306.6°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Princeton, In bearing 237.8° or WSW .
- Princeton, In has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Jerba has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h).
- The average annual temperature is 7.2 °C (13°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 11.7 °C (21.1°F) more in Princeton, In.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 933.5 mm (36.8 in) more which is equivalent to 933.5 l/m² (22.91 US gal/ft²) or 9,335,000 l/ha (997,973 US gal/ac) more. About 5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4.1° lower in Princeton, In than in Jerba.
